Reading "The Island of Dr.Moreau" has given me the idea for this thread. What are we at our core? In the book, Dr. Moreau turns tries with varying degrees of sucsess to turn animals into humans, bringing up the idea to me that at our core, all our instincts and primitive emotions, are from animals. We, humans and animals, exhibit the same basic emotions. As the life of these newly created "humans", who look more like demented hybrids with humanoid shapes, more and more of their animal nature surfaces and they turn back into the beasts they once were.

Discuss:
What are we at our core? Do we come from animals or from a god/gods who made us like animals or seperated us from them? What seperates us from them and are we so very different? What makes us the same? We kill, we eat, we find mates, and know fear as do animals, but "are we not men?"How far away are we from beasts or is there some gift or some divine spark wich seperates us?

"What makes humans human?" is a long standing philosophical question, and one which is inherently tied into the question of "What seperates humans and everything else?".

There are certain traits that directly seperate us from all other species-

1) We create art.
2) We create law, and in turn, have systems of ethics and punishment.
3) We create fire.
4) We wear clothes, even when unneeded (such as on a comfortable spring day).
5) We cook our food.

However, whether these are constructs of the group or constructs of the individual? That's more arguable. Will a human unable to cook their food cease to eat? No. Will a human unable to create art cease to live? No.

Stripped of the capability to preform these tasks, we become all the more animal. Which also brings forth the question, "Are we trying to become more, or just trying to avoid becoming less?".
